The 'Vibe' Check: Who Thrives Here?
Portsmouth is home to about 24,430 people, making it a fairly compact community. With a median gross rent of $1,313, it is essential to budget accordingly if you are planning to rent. The city has a relatively low education rate, with only 22.5% of residents holding a bachelor's degree. Additionally, the renter population is significant, with 33.7% of residents renting their homes. The lack of public transit options means that car ownership is almost mandatory for commuting and daily activities.
Probably not your spot if you are looking for a strong public transit system or a higher percentage of college-educated residents.

Crime & Safety: What the Numbers Say
In Virginia, the annual violent crime rate is 203.3 per 100,000 residents, which is significantly lower than the national average of 325.3. Property crime is also lower in Virginia, with a rate of 1,346.3 per 100,000 compared to the national rate of 1,546.9. Notably, the state has seen a 22% decrease in property crime since 2022, and a 15.2% drop in violent crime during the same period.
- Violent crime: 203.3 per 100k vs. national 325.3, showing a 15.2% decrease since 2022.
- Property crime: 1,346.3 per 100k vs. national 1,546.9, with a 22% decrease since 2022.
- Notable trend: Homicides have dropped by 43.2% since 2022, now at 4.2 per 100k.

Weather & Getting Outside
Portsmouth experiences an average annual precipitation of 45.5 inches, with about 115 rainy days each year. Notably, winter sees only 0.5 inches of snow, with just 5 snow days, making it relatively mild.
